Summer Vogue:The Rise of National-Style Cheongsam for Young Girls in Hanfu Fashion

In the heart of summer, a new trend is taking the breath of the nation by storm - the revival of traditional Hanfu attire in the form of national-style cheongsam for Young girls. This summer, little girls are donning the essence of Chinese culture in their clothing, embracing a style that embodies the essence of elegance and tradition.

The essence of Hanfu culture is beautifully captured in the design of these summer cheongsam dresses. These are not mere fashion statements but a blend of ancient craftsmanship and modern aesthetics. The vibrant colors, intricate patterns, and meticulous craftsmanship bring out the beauty of the traditional cheongsam while incorporating modern designs and cuts to make it comfortable for young girls to wear during summer.

The use of lightweight materials like cotton and silk makes these cheongsam dresses perfect for summer wear. The breathable fabrics provide comfort and ease while allowing the wearer to show off their playful side. The designs are often adorned with floral prints or traditional Chinese patterns like dragon and phoenix, which not only look stunning but also carry a deep cultural significance.
